Abstract
224,877. British Thomson-Houston Co., Ltd., (Assignees of Nolte, H. J., and Prindle, R. B.). Nov. 13, 1923, [Convention date]. Vacuum tubes. - A c a t h o d e structure which comprises a pedestal 11, Fig. 1, of refractory metal such as tungsten, carrying an insulating anchor 14, is supported solely by the two leads 5, 6. The pedestal is clamped to the leads 5, 6 by metal p l a t e s 12 separated by mica and secured together by wire 13. The anchor consists of a quartz sleeve grooved to receive bands 15, Fig. 2, of refractory metal such as molybdenum, in which are held hooks 17 for the bights of the filaments 19, 20. A plate 22 welded to the pedestal is formed with a, lug 23 engaging with the anchor to prevent rotation. The filaments are connected in series by welding the ends to the leads 5, 6 and to a cross-piece on the pedestal. The leads are joined to cones 7 sealed into a re-entrant glass stem 4, and are provided with shields 9 for preventing ionic bombardment of the seals. Quartz sleeves 8 are mounted around the leads, and a glass sheath 10 surrounds the stem 4.
